深度解析BIND软件,网络设备管理的利器bind软件

深度解析BIND软件,网络设备管理的利器bind软件,

本文目录导读:

  1. BIND软件的基本功能
  2. BIND软件的安装与配置
  3. BIND软件的常见问题
  4. BIND软件的高级功能

BIND软件的基本功能

BIND软件是一款功能强大的网络设备管理工具,主要用于配置和管理网络设备,其核心功能包括:

  1. 网络设备管理
    BIND软件能够管理数百个甚至数千个网络设备,包括路由器、交换机、防火墙等,它通过配置管理功能,确保所有设备保持一致的配置,避免设备配置不一致导致的网络问题。

  2. 故障排查与恢复
    作为网络设备的“医生”,BIND软件能够快速定位设备的故障原因,通过命令行界面(CLI)和图形用户界面(GUI),管理员可以实时监控设备状态,并通过远程故障恢复功能快速将设备恢复正常。

  3. 性能监控与优化
    BIND软件能够实时监控网络设备的性能指标,如CPU使用率、内存使用率、网络接口流量等,管理员可以通过这些数据优化设备配置,避免网络拥塞和性能下降。

  4. 批量配置与脚本管理
    在企业网络中,管理员需要对多个设备进行批量配置,BIND软件支持批量配置命令,并允许管理员编写简单的脚本,实现自动化管理。


BIND软件的安装与配置

BIND软件支持多种操作系统,包括Windows、macOS和Linux,以下是安装和配置的基本步骤。

安装BIND软件

  • Windows版本
    Windows版本的BIND软件可以通过官方网站下载,支持32位和64位系统,安装后,默认安装路径为C:\bind, 配置文件存储在C:\bind\config

  • macOS版本
    macOS版本的BIND软件通过Fink源自动下载,安装后默认配置文件存储在~/config(bind)

  • Linux版本
    Linux版本的BIND软件通过包管理器安装,配置文件通常存储在~/.bind/config

首次登录

首次登录BIND软件时,系统会提示您输入用户名和密码,默认情况下,用户名为root,密码为password

基本命令

  • show version:显示当前版本信息。
    示例:

    root@设备名$ show version  
    Version 1.0.2  
  • show interfaces:显示所有接口信息。
    示例:

    root@设备名$ show interfaces  
    Interface 0/0:  
    Description:  
    MTU: 488  
    Bandwidth: 1000000000  
    State: UP  
  • config t:进入配置模式。
    示例:

    root@设备名$ config t  
    (配置界面)  
  • exit:退出配置模式。
    示例:

    root@设备名$ exit  

配置管理

管理员可以通过bind-config工具批量配置网络设备,可以将一个设备的默认网关设置为另一个设备。


BIND软件的常见问题

在使用BIND软件时,可能会遇到一些常见问题,以下是几种常见的问题及解决方案。

设备无法连接到BIND服务器

如果设备无法连接到BIND服务器,可能的原因包括:

  • 网络配置问题
    检查设备的IP地址是否正确,并确保设备能够访问BIND服务器的URL(如bind://192.168.1.100:2181)。

  • DNS配置问题
    确保设备的DNS服务器设置正确,并且可以访问BIND软件的DNS记录。

  • 权限问题
    检查设备是否有权限访问BIND服务器,可能需要调整设备的组权限。

配置命令无法生效

如果配置命令无法生效,可能的原因包括:

  • 命令错误
    检查命令语法是否正确,确保没有拼写错误或语法错误。

  • 设备状态问题
    确保设备处于可配置状态(如设备在线,无故障)。

  • 网络配置冲突
    检查是否有其他设备的配置与当前配置冲突。

性能问题

如果网络设备性能下降,可能的原因包括:

  • 过载
    检查设备的CPU和内存使用率,确保没有过载。

  • 日志问题
    查看设备的日志文件(如config.log),查找错误信息。

  • 软件更新
    确保BIND软件和设备固件都已更新到最新版本。


BIND软件的高级功能

对于有一定经验的管理员来说,BIND软件的高级功能是必不可少的工具,以下是几种高级功能的介绍。

批量配置

管理员可以通过BIND软件批量配置多个设备,可以将所有设备的默认网关设置为同一个设备。

脚本编写

BIND软件支持脚本语言(BIE),管理员可以通过编写脚本自动化网络设备的配置和维护,可以编写一个脚本来自动重置所有设备的密码。

高级监控

管理员可以通过BIND软件的高级监控功能,设置告警规则,当设备出现异常时,自动发送通知。

安全管理

BIND软件还支持安全配置,管理员可以通过配置防火墙规则,保护网络设备免受外部攻击。

深度解析BIND软件,网络设备管理的利器bind软件,

发表评论